Council Chairman empowers 200 Women in Niger

As part of efforts to fulfill his promises, the Chairman of Chanchaga Local Government Area of Niger State, Ibrahim Abubakar Lalalo has empowered two hundred women with the sum of two million naira (N2,000,000).
The Chairman during the flag-off ceremony, promised to continue the implementation of policies and programmes that will reduce the sufferings and hardships of the people.
Lalalo while appealing to the beneficiaries to make judicious use of the funds, promised to implement programmes that will address the challenges of the residents.
While lamenting the Council’s inability to pay 100% and its resolve to Staff salary payment in percentage, he said it was due to over blotted staff strength of over two thousand workforce.
Lalalo then appealed to workers to be patient with the current situation stating that he requires about N272 million monthly but only gets a little over N138 million leaving a deficit of over N130 million that the council can not generate in a month.
He explained that the council had resolved with the labour not to retrench workers as such would expose many to hardship hence the need to pay in percentage until normalcy is restored.
The Council Speaker, Sani Imam, however appreciated the Chairman for the Initiative, assuring that the council will continue to support people oriented programmes that have direct impact on the lives of the people.
Some of the beneficiaries commended the Chairman for the kind gesture assuring to make judicious use of the funds.
